Tom Dowie Hunger Strike ‘Guess Who’s Coming To Dinner, Annette ?’
“I am heading to Wellington to get Annette King to show some accountability in regards to listening to the people’s desire to retain Queen Mary Hospital” says Tom Dowie, on day 10 of his hunger strike at the Canterbury District Health Board’s decision to sell the site of the former Queen Mary Hospital.
“I am grateful for the support of the many hundreds of people who have signed the petition in support of retaining the Hospital land”, says Mr Dowie. “It is now time to take this message to Wellington so that the powers that be can no longer ignore it”.
Mr Dowie will be present tomorrow at Parliament steps from 10am to seek support for the Hospital as well as possibly attending Minister King’s electorate office to speak to her directly. “It is a shame that the Minister has been unwilling to talk to me on the phone about this, leaving me no alternative but to bring this important message to Parliament.”
